Comparative variational studies of 0^+ states in three-α models

Three variational approaches, the hyperspherical-harmonics, Gaussian-basis and Lagrange-mesh methods involving different coordinate systems, are compared in studies of $0^+$ bound-state energies in 3$\alpha$ models. Calculations are performed with different versions of the shallow Ali-Bodmer potential (with and without Coulomb) and with the deep Buck-Friedrich-Wheatley potential. All three methods yield very accurate energies. Their advantages and drawbacks are evaluated. The implications of the disagreement between the obtained results and the experimental $^{12}$C energies in $3\alpha$ models with Coulomb interaction are discussed.
